Dr. Firouzian placed veneers on my teeth about a year and a half ago. They were very large and bulky and looked far worse than my original teeth. After a year of haggling, he finally agreed to redo them. He admitted that they were "over exaggerated" and redid my veneers. They looked better, but still not great, and definitely not worth the $5000+ that I paid him. I wish now that I would have done more research and gone to a dentist that had the skills to do good cosmetic dentistry. It seemed like he was more concerned with selling me veneers than how they actually looked. The new veneers he installed have since started moving around -- the lateral incisors shift when I bite into food. Just last night one of the lateral incisors cracked and a big chunk fell off the bottom. When I called their office today, the receptionist was very curt and said they would have to get back to me on Monday to schedule an appointment. I would avoid this dentist at all costs for cosmetic work. I w as naive to blindly trust him. Now that I've done some research into porcelain veneers, I realize that he skipped or sped through some steps that better dentists would pay attention to. The least I can do is tell others so they don't experience the same problems.

Reasons he gave initially for the giant, "over-exaggerated" veneers that he installed were that he did not make a wax-up model before hand, so the laboratory had to craft the veneers using photographs only. Also, he said that the first laboratory he sent the veneers to was not a very good lab, but that they had a fast turnaround time. The second set of veneers he installed, he said he sent to a different lab which produced better results. Although the second set of veneers was better, they are not functional as one lateral incisor has already broke, and the other lateral incisor shifts in my mouth whenever I eat. I try to eat with my back teeth only to avoid moving the veneers and possibly damaging them.

I don't feel that these will last me 10 years and I feel that I wasted over $5000 on sub standard cosmetic dentistry.

This office is ruthless when it comes to upselling cosmetic dental procedures. Even the receptionists get in on the act. The cosmetic outcome in my case was way below what my expectations were. I've since looked at some of his case photos and I can see that he generally makes large, unbalanced teeth that appear more like dentures than natural teeth.

The whole office is rushed due to patients stacked back to back. It was impossible for the dentist to really spend the time required for a good cosmetic outcome because he was working on 2 or 3 of us at once.

Please be careful of this office. I wish I had never gone there. I'm looking at thousands of dollars to repair what's broken. I had a balance on my account of about $300. When I asked them to make an arrangement with me the head receptionist there sent my balance to a collection agency with a 40% fee tacked on. So I'm walking away from their office $5000 poorer and a bill from a legal office. I'm also walking away with a broken veneer and one that moves and will likely break or fail soon.
